How much do linux projects j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 5, 2026, the average hourly pay for linux projects in the United States is $55.32,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$50.24 and $59.38 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are some common challenges faced when managing Linux projects in a collaborative environment?

Managing Linux projects often involves coordinating contributions from multiple team members, each possibly working on different distributions or toolsets. A common challenge is ensuring consistency across development environments and maintaining clear documentation for configuration and deployment processes. Effective version control and communication are essential to avoid conflicts and ensure smooth integration of code changes. Teams often use collaborative tools and regular stand-ups to address issues promptly and keep everyone aligned on project goals.

Linux Projects involve planning, executing, and managing specific Linux-related initiatives, often requiring project management skills and certifications. Linux System Administrators focus on maintaining, configuring, and troubleshooting Linux systems on a day-to-day basis. While both roles require Linux knowledge, Projects are more about overseeing initiatives, whereas Administrators handle ongoing system operations.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in Linux projects, and why are they important?

To excel in Linux projects, you need a strong understanding of Linux operating systems, scripting, and system administration, often supported by a degree in computer science or related certifications like CompTIA Linux+ or Red Hat Certified System Administrator (RHCSA). Familiarity with tools such as Bash, Git, Docker, and configuration management systems like Ansible or Puppet is typically required. Problem-solving, teamwork, and effective communication are essential soft skills for collaborating on complex technical issues. These competencies ensure efficient project execution, system reliability, and successful collaboration in dynamic IT environments.

What are Linux Projects?

Linux projects refer to tasks, initiatives, or assignments that involve the Linux operating system. These projects can range from developing software applications, configuring servers, managing system security, to contributing to open-source projects based on Linux. Many organizations and developers use Linux projects to build scalable systems, automate processes, and improve IT infrastructure. Participating in Linux projects helps individuals gain hands-on experience with system administration, networking, scripting, and troubleshooting. The open-source nature of Linux also encourages community collaboration and continuous learning.
